Cactus Wren

Cactus wrens are strictly a southern species, with a range extending from Southern California, east to the Lower Rio Grande Valley in Texas.

Their unique look makes them easy to distinguish from other wren species. They are medium sized birds that dress up the typical wren brown color with a dark spotted breast.

Like other wren species, the Cactus wren forages on the ground for insects and spiders. Unlike other wren species, they also eat seeds.

Cactus wrens are designated the state bird of Arizona.
